Subject: DR drill follow-up — Corvette Payments

Team, during yesterday's disaster-recovery drill for the Corvette payments service, the flaky integration tests in the settlement suite masked a genuine failover timeout. Please quarantine those tests rather than retrying them blindly, and document each quarantine in the drill log so future maintainers can trace decisions. To restore the drill-environment credentials vault after quarantine, use the recovery passphrase noted directly below this message.

recovery phrase for kawep-kawep: caseth-gorael-quenmir-olieth-ulavan-fenwyn-eliix-fraox-zorok

**TICKET: Splitwick vault locked, assignment service stalled**

Hey — quick one for review. The Splitwick A/B assignment service can't read experiment salts because its vault locked overnight. My fix retries with backoff, but to verify locally you'll need to reopen the vault yourself. Use the recovery passphrase below.

vault phrase of kawep-tahog = ulaix-briath

## Changelog — Threadloom GraphQL service 2.9

Defaults changed to close the N+1 query pattern flagged in the last review. The resolver layer now batches entity lookups through a request-scoped dataloader by default; per-field ad-hoc queries are disabled unless explicitly allowed. This reduces database round trips and, relevantly for review, shrinks the window in which row-level authorization checks could be bypassed by repeated fetches. Batch size and cache scoping are bounded; the shipped defaults are listed here.

deployment values, yadug-bawif:
[framir]
team = pelox
access_code = ac_a38ab2
owner = tamion.julael
host = framir.tolvaqlabs.test
port = 11211
peer = tammir.zemvargrid.local
salt = 2215ef03
pin = 1541

## Changelog — Font vendoring defaults changed

As of this release, the Bracken UI build no longer fetches third-party fonts at build time. All typefaces used by the Lanternwell suite are now vendored into the repo under a dedicated assets directory, and the fetch step is skipped by default. If you're onboarding, nothing to install — the fonts travel with the checkout. The build flags controlling this behavior are listed below.

settings of hadup-yafog:
LAMAEL_PIN=3761
LAMAEL_TENANT=istmir
LAMAEL_METRICS_HOST=metrics.lamael.plorvasys.test
LAMAEL_SEAL=seal_8ea68500
LAMAEL_STANDBY_TEAM=fraok